1. Overview of SerpClix and SerpSEO: What Do They Offer?
SerpClix and SerpSEO are both designed to increase a website’s organic click-through rate by mimicking genuine user activity on Google search results. SerpClix operates primarily as a crowd-sourced platform, where real human clickers are paid to search for a keyword, scroll through the results, and click on a specific site. This gives it a more human-like edge and can help to bypass Google’s sophisticated bot-detection algorithms. On the other hand, SerpSEO offers a more controlled automation system with smart IP rotation and device emulation to mimic real user behavior. It allows users to customize geographic targeting, dwell time, and even simulate browsing other pages on the site, offering more flexibility for SEO professionals who need advanced targeting options.
